In Ilorin, an ex-convict was re-arrested for trafficking crack cocaine

 


Yusuf Sherifat, 36, was recently re-arrested by agents of the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A) in Ilorin, Kwara State, after serving a prison sentence for dealing in 22 grams of crack (c*caine).

According to Femi Babafemi, the Agency's Director of Media and Advocacy, the ex-convict was apprehended on Tuesday, September 7, along Specialist Hospital Road, Alagbado, Ilorin, following intelligence reports that she had started crack (cocaine) sales in the city. She invented a new method of distributing drugs along the road to known customers who contact her via phone calls this time.
